After the 2.9 update i experience allot of crashes lately with MT. Mostly Crash Reboot. The game runs fine at start, but suddenly without notice its crash reboots. I had this today at least 3 times within 2 days. I play mostly my own missions. Its just a debug mission (for coding purpose) with nothing fancy in it. I'm testing the AH-64D and checking some events it generates like S_EVENT_HIT / S_EVENT_SHOT.

Please remove all unofficial mods and run a slow repair or verify if steam. 

You have 65GB RAM, if you wish to you can set your pagefile to auto, it will save some room on your disc. 

Ensure windows is up to date and all drivers.
